What companies run services between Rio Tinto (Station), Portugal and Porto, Portugal?
Comboios de Portugal operates a train from Rio Tinto to Porto Sao Bento every 10 minutes. Tickets cost €1–2 and the journey takes 12 min. Alternatively, STCP operates a bus from Rio Tinto - Estação to Campo Lindo every 30 minutes. Tickets cost €3 and the journey takes 20 min.
